Family friendly hiking trails in Arequipa traverse a diverse landscape characterized by towering volcanoes like El Misti, deep canyons such as Colca Canyon, and high-altitude plains. The region features dramatic red rock walls, ancient agricultural terraces, and unique geological formations like stone forests. Hikers can explore vast natural reserves with salt flats and lagoons, offering varied terrain for outdoor activities. These paths provide opportunities to experience Arequipa's distinctive volcanic and puna environments.

September 28, 2024, Museo Santuarios Andinos

The highlight of this museum is the body of "Juanita, the girl from Ampato". To begin with, you can see a film about the discovery and preservation of the mummy in the Andes. The first room is the introductory room, where texts and presentations about the Andean sanctuary project and the chronology of the Incas are shown. The next five rooms exhibit ceramics, metals, textiles and organic materials.

The Church of San Juan Bautista de Yanahuara is very special because its construction is made entirely of sillar, a characteristic stone of the city of Arequipa since it is present in monuments, houses, squares and other buildings.

The Yanahuara viewpoint offers a privileged view of Arequipa and its three volcanoes, the Misti, Pichu Pichu and the Chachani.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many family-friendly hiking trails are available in Arequipa?

Our guide features a selection of four family-friendly hiking routes in Arequipa, ranging from easy to moderate difficulty. These trails are designed to be enjoyable for both children and adults, offering manageable distances and gentle paths.

What is the easiest family-friendly hike in Arequipa?

For an easy and enjoyable family outing, consider the Yanahuara Viewpoint – Arequipa Main Square loop from Arequipa. This route is approximately 7 km long with minimal elevation gain, making it perfect for families with younger children or those looking for a relaxed stroll.

Are there any circular routes suitable for families in Arequipa?

Yes, all the family-friendly routes in this guide are circular, meaning you'll end up back where you started. For example, the San Francisco Square, Arequipa – San Camilo Market loop offers a pleasant circular walk through the city's charming areas.

What kind of attractions can we see along the family-friendly hiking trails in Arequipa?

Many of the family-friendly routes in Arequipa pass by significant cultural and historical sites. You can explore the beautiful Arequipa's Plaza de Armas and Cathedral, the iconic San Francisco Square, and the impressive Santa Catalina Monastery. These urban hikes offer a great way to combine outdoor activity with sightseeing.

What do other hikers enjoy most about family-friendly hikes in Arequipa?

The komoot community highly rates the family-friendly hikes in Arequipa, with an average score of 4.83 out of 5 stars. Reviewers often praise the accessibility of the trails, the stunning views of the surrounding volcanoes like El Misti, and the opportunity to explore the city's unique architecture and vibrant markets.

Are there any routes that offer scenic viewpoints of Arequipa's volcanoes?

Absolutely! The Arequipa Main Square – Yanahuara Viewpoint loop is an excellent choice. This route leads you to the famous Yanahuara Viewpoint, which provides panoramic vistas of Arequipa's 'White City' and the majestic volcanoes like El Misti, Chachani, and Pichu Pichu that frame the landscape.

What is the typical duration for these family-friendly hikes?

The family-friendly hikes in Arequipa typically range from 1 hour 55 minutes to 2 hours 45 minutes to complete, depending on the route and your family's pace. This makes them ideal for a half-day outing without being overly strenuous for children.

Are there any markets or local spots to explore on these family routes?

Yes, some routes incorporate local markets and vibrant city areas. The San Camilo Market – Arequipa Main Square loop, for instance, allows you to experience the bustling atmosphere of San Camilo Market, offering a glimpse into local life and culture.

What is the best time of year for family hikes in Arequipa?

Arequipa generally enjoys a dry climate with abundant sunshine, making it suitable for hiking year-round. However, the dry season from April to November is often preferred, as it offers clear skies and comfortable temperatures, ideal for enjoying the trails and volcanic views.

Are these trails suitable for beginners or families new to hiking?

Yes, the routes in this guide are specifically chosen for their family-friendly nature, making them suitable for beginners. They feature manageable distances and relatively gentle terrain, ensuring a pleasant experience for those new to hiking or families with young children.

What should we pack for a family day hike in Arequipa?

For a family day hike in Arequipa, it's advisable to pack essentials like water, snacks, sun protection (hat, sunscreen), comfortable walking shoes, and layers of clothing as temperatures can vary. Don't forget a camera to capture the stunning views of the city and volcanoes!
